Ferrari now knows the cause of the problem encountered by Charles Leclerc in Bahrain

Ferrari revealed they identified Leclerc's issue that cost him the victory in Bahrain.

While Charles Leclerc was guiding his Ferrari towards an inevitable victory in Bahrain, a mechanical problem on the 46th lap relegated him to 3rd place and possibly further back if the Safety Car hadn’t come out due to the double Renault retirement. A small issue that will have significant consequences as it cost the Monegasque driver 5 seconds per lap. A very surprising problem as the F1 world was preparing to welcome the Ferrari’s young Prince as the 108th driver to step onto the top of the podium. But motorsport is cruel, and Leclerc will have to wait a bit longer for his first victory.

These reliability issues are all too familiar to Ferrari with their consequences to ignore. It is these same errors that, in 2017, turned the Asian tour into a nightmare for the tifosi.

The Italian team seems to have found what cost Leclerc the victory on the Sakhir track. It appears to be a short circuit in the injection system. Despite this problem, the prancing horse team has confirmed that the young Monegasque driver will use the same engine for the Chinese Grand Prix.
